Table 3.

Interaction between current smoking status and employment position with the belief that smoking does not impact anti-tuberculosis treatment

Prevalence of the belief that smoking does not impact anti-tuberculosis treatment, n/N (%)
Physician (n = 86) Nurse (n = 202)
Current smoker 7/16 (43.8) 5/16 (31.3)
Non/past smoker 12/70 (17.1) 57/186 (30.7)
Prevalence difference, % (95%CI) 26.7 (0.7–52.5) 0.6 (−23.1 to 24.3)
aOR (95%CI)*
Current smoker 5.11 (1.46–17.90) 1.00 (0.32–3.08)
Non/past smoker Reference Reference
*

Multivariable model was adjusted for employment position, age, sex, and years of education.

aOR = adjusted odds ratio; CI = confidence interval.
